The regional chapter of the American Red Cross wants to boost its volunteer corps.

It’s launching a new online tool called "Volunteer Connection," which allows users to type in a zip code and an area of interest, and locate a need.

Red Cross spokesman Doug Bishop hopes Internet users will try the match-making service. 

"Between the economy and what we all seem to have going on in our lives these days it’s difficult to squeeze in a volunteer opportunity and that’s why we have to constantly remind folks of the availability of that option, that people have the ability and we hope the desire to help their community," Bishop said.

The Red Cross will also be recruiting volunteers at the HomeLife Expo at the Dartmouth Field House in Hanover this weekend.

The new initiative comes in the wake of two major disasters in recent years and a winter plagued by house fires.
